  • Reply 3 of 13
    You don't happen to say, live in London, do you?



    Apple doesn't have rights to any U.K. TV shows, they can only distribute US shows in the US.

    Just out of curiosity how much do TV episodes cost? Are they charged per epsidode, is discount given for an entire series? How much are these? Thanks
  • Reply 5 of 13
    It's $1.99 for an episode, and generally around $34.99 for an entire season (generally 22 episodes in the US, so you save $10), unless it's something daily like the Colbert Report where its $34.99 for a few weeks worth of shows.



    I imagine though that it, like most American things, is gonna be a lot more expensive in the UK, between VAT and other markups. We pay $0.99 for songs, and you pay something like .79 pounds?



    Apple doesn't really have their international prices in order.
